1. Let the FordPass® App Do the Heavy Lifting
One of the most premium features of the Mach-E is the ability to set a “Departure Time” via the FordPass® App. Instead of waiting for your car to warm up while you’re behind the wheel, you can schedule it to warm up while it’s still plugged into your home charger.
Your Mach-E will automatically bring the battery to its optimal operating temperature and pre-set the cabin to your favorite climate. By the time you’re ready to pull out of your Hawthorne driveway, your car is primed for maximum efficiency, and you haven’t used a single mile of your battery range to get there.
2. Experience the Comfort of Targeted Heat
Ford designed the Mach-E with efficiency in mind, including how it keeps you cozy. On a crisp morning, using your heated seats and heated steering wheel is the most efficient way to stay warm.
Because these features heat your body directly rather than warming the entire cabin, they use significantly less energy. It’s a more “targeted” luxury that keeps you comfortable while preserving your battery for long stretches of the 105 or 405.
3. “Set it and Forget It” with One-Pedal Drive
If you’re navigating the typical stop-and-go traffic around Redondo or West LA, One-Pedal Drive is your best friend. It’s a smart feature that uses regenerative braking to recharge your battery when you lift off the accelerator. It’s not just a more relaxing way to drive in traffic; it’s an effortless way to boost your range throughout the day.
4. A Quick “Health Check” for Your Tires
Just like a gas-powered vehicle, keeping your tires at the recommended pressure is key to efficiency. As temperatures fluctuate throughout March, a quick glance at your tire pressure helps ensure you have the lowest rolling resistance, keeping your drive smooth and your range high.
